People searching NXG MARKETS regulation or regulation NXG MARKETS need to separate an overseas licence from permission in India. The Reserve Bank of India Alert List, updated 19 November 2025, names NXG Markets and nxgmarkets.com. RBI says listed entities are neither authorised to deal in forex under FEMA nor authorised to run an approved forex electronic trading platform. The broker's own site also says it does not serve residents or citizens of India. This NXG MARKETS review found an overseas Mwali licence record, but no RBI authorisation. No cited court ruling proves fraud. For an Indian user, the local warning and service restriction should control the decision.
